Abstract
An integrated circuit chip includes a rectifier circuit configured to convert an alternating voltage supplied from an antenna into a direct-current voltage, a nonvolatile memory coupled to the rectifier circuit to operate by use of the direct-current voltage, a sensor circuit coupled to the rectifier circuit to operate by use of the direct-current voltage to collect measurement data, and a logic circuit configured to control the nonvolatile memory and the sensor circuit such that an access operation of the nonvolatile memory and a data collecting operation of the sensor circuit are not performed concurrently.

5. An RFID system, comprising:
-
a reader writer configured to transmit/receive a radio wave; and
an IC tag configured to communicate with said reader writer through the radio wave,wherein said IC tag includes; an antenna; a rectifier circuit coupled to said antenna to convert an alternating voltage of the radio wave received by said antenna into a first direct-current voltage; a nonvolatile memory coupled to said rectifier circuit to operate by use of the first direct-current voltage; a sensor circuit coupled to said rectifier circuit to operate by use of the first direct-current voltage to collect measurement data; a logic circuit configured to control said nonvolatile memory and said sensor circuit such that write access operation of said nonvolatile memory and a data collecting operation of said sensor circuit are not performed concurrently; and a data modulation circuit configured to modulate the measurement data, wherein control is performed such that an write access operation of said nonvolatile memory and a data collecting operation of said sensor circuit are not performed concurrently, wherein the write access operation of said nonvolatile memory is performed before the modulated measurement data is output via the antenna, wherein the logic circuit operates by use of a second direct-current voltage, and the second direct-current voltage is lower than the first direct-current voltage. - View Dependent Claims (6, 9, 12)
